The FEI Eventing & Driving Department will be looking for a Sports Administrator for a 9-months’ fixed term contract with the possibility of extension and potential for a permanent resource within the Department. You will join a newly formed Department where the two disciplines, Eventing & Driving, are being brought together to create synergies and foster collaboration between both disciplines. The position’s activity rate is 100% and the location is Lausanne, Switzerland. This position is available immediately or upon agreement.
Sports Administrator
Purpose of the Role
Reporting to the Director Eventing & Driving the candidate will provide administrative support to ensure the effective coordination and delivery of competition-related activities. This includes competition schedules, maintaining accurate records and results and preparing related reports. The position also supports the Eventing & Driving Department’s overall administrative functions.
Key Responsibilities
Data, Reports and Competition Administration
- Review and approval of schedules
- Follow-up, reminder procedures for missing schedules, calendar updates
- Publication of schedules on the FEI Database and follow-up of necessary updates
- Create competitions in the FEI Database further to schedule approval and open Entry system
- Event results management
- Send out, follow-up, collection and reminders of Officials’ reports
- Provide feedback after events to Organising Committees, National Federations, Technical Delegates
- Review of competitions calendar with edition, revision and keeping information up to date
- Provide National Federations with support regarding the online schedule, entry and results
- Provide general administrative assistance as required
Position Requirements
- Diploma in Business Administration (CFC) required; a Bachelor’s degree in Business Management or a related field is a plus;
- Minimum of 2 years of administrative experience required;
- Genuine interest or knowledge of equestrian sports;
- Fluency in English (spoken and written);
- Excellent command of MS Office;
- Ability to work well under pressure and meet deadlines;
- Strong organisational skills and attention to detail;
- Team-oriented with excellent interpersonal skills.
